Search for local turkeys online
The National Farmers Union (NFU) is urging shoppers who want to buy locally reared, good-quality Christmas turkey to head online.
Visitors to the UK Turkeys website – www.ukturkeys.co.uk – can search for a local turkey producer using only their postcode. The ‘turkey finder’ database includes 340 UK producers, up from 70 when the site was first launched in 2005. The website also includes information on different breeds and why it is important to buy local, as well as recipes ideas and tips for choosing and carving a turkey for Christmas.
Shoppers can also enter a competition to win one of five Christmas hampers, which include a Kelly Bronze turkey and other festive goods from suppliers registered with the Safe and Local Supplier Approval (SALSA) scheme.
Michael Bailey, a seasonal turkey producer and vice-chairman of the NFU poultry board representing turkeys, said: “Nothing beats a locally reared bird to treat your family. This website gives the shopper a chance to support British produce, help the local economy and guarantee a product with a fantastic taste.
“You can also speak to the farmer who reared the turkey that will end up as the centrepiece of your Christmas dinner. There are hundreds of producers to choose from and all budgets are catered for.”
